Margate 1-1 Maidstone United
Monday 30 August
Ryman Premier Division
Attendance: 641
Reporter: Ruth Tunnell

At the fourth attempt The Stones have finally registered their first point of the season thanks to an unfortunate own goal by Laurence Ball.

Maidstone will be disappointed not to have claimed all three points though as for the third game in the a row they failed to hold onto the lead and finally succumbed to concerted pressure from Margate when Wayne Wilson struck a fabulous equaliser just six minutes from time.

This was an entertaining game with plenty of goalmouth action to entertain the bumper crowd at Hartsdown Park. On eight minutes Shaun Welford was fouled and Wilson whipped in the resultant free-kick which struck Simon Glover and deflected just wide of the left hand post.

Then two minutes later Wilson found Welford with a deep cross and the former Dover striker headed the ball wide.

Shortly afterwards The Stones had their first attempt on goal after the excellent Jake Hobbs found Adrian Stone out on the right wing. Stone’s ball into Danny Hockton wasn’t ideal and he could not generate enough power behind his shot to beat Jamie Turner in the Margate goal.

The game immediately swung to the other end as former Stones favourite Aaron Lacy was left in acres of space and given enough time to deliver the ball to another Maidstone player, James Pinnock, who should have done better with his headed effort.

After this Maidstone began to put the home side under pressure and on 19 minutes a decent corner from Colin Richmond dropped to Stone who turned and fired a fierce shot goalwards only for Turner to make a smart block.

It was then the home side’s turn to dominate and on 25 minutes Lacy was once again left in space and this time he found Curtis Robinson who shot just over the bar and then two minutes later Welford got on the end of a long kick from Turner but Walker made a good stop.

Sixty seconds later Maidstone nearly paid the price for leaving Lacy in space on the right as he lofted a good cross into the box which was met by Darren Marsden and he saw his header strike the bottom of the post before being gathered by Walker.

After the break Margate put The Stones under pressure once again and they went close on 57 minutes when Walker was drawn from his goal to head the ball and it fell to Pinnock but he failed to hit the target with his lobbed shot.

However, the deadlock was broken on 64 minutes when Walker launched a long goal kick down field which Ball connected with and his flicked header flew into the net past the stranded Turner.

Going behind meant that Margate were once again keen to exert pressure on The Stones but Maidstone were still occasionally creating chances and on 76 minutes Stone connected with a free-kick from Richmond but his header was stopped by Turner.

Unfortunately for Maidstone though they could not stop the home side from equalising six minutes from time when Wilson gained possession just outside the area and curled the ball into the top right hand corner of the net.

Two minutes later Hobbs ‘ determination saw him win the ball and run into the area but just as he was about to shoot he was denied by an excellent sliding challenge from Robinson. Then with the game in stoppage time there was a scare for Maidstone as a goalmouth scramble resulted in the ball being cleared off the line but The Stones held on to gain a valuable point.
